Aggressive Behaviour
Actions intended to harm or cause discomfort to another, driven by various factors including environmental, biological, and psychological.
Physical Punishment
The use of physical force with the intention of causing a child to experience pain, but not injury, for the purpose of correction or control.
Operant Behaviour
A type of learning where behavior is controlled by consequences (reinforcements or punishments).
Conditional Response
A learned response to a previously neutral stimulus that becomes conditioned through association with an unconditioned stimulus.
